Two low-noise differential input amplifiers designed for voltage and current fluctuation measurements in epithelia are described. The first one uses a matched pair of low-noise transistors and is particularly suited for low-frequency current and voltage noise measurements in frog skin and other preparations with impedances below 1 kOmega. The second one is designed around a matched pair of JFETs and can also be used for higher source impedance. Performance is demonstrated with Na(+) current power density spectra obtained from frog skin with the transistor-input stage. 相似文献

An assay using reversed-phase high-performance liquid chromatography with ultraviolet detection, at 278 nm, was developed to measure diclofenac in human plasma and urine at concentrations suitable for biopharmaceutical studies. Indomethacin was used as internal standard and separation was performed at 40 degrees C on a C18 Spherisorb column with acetonitrile-0.1 M sodium acetate (35:65, v/v) (pH 6.3) as mobile phase. The sample preparation is simple and rapid (extractionless), and the total run time is less than 5 min. The retention time is 2.8 min for diclofenac and 3.6 min for indomethacin. The detection limit is 0.2 microgram/ml using a 20-microliters loop. 相似文献

An investigation of the behavior of poly(methyl methacrylate co ethyl acrylate) with a commercially available filament-type pyrolysis unit and gas chromatogaph was conducted. It has been hypothesized that the quantity of ethyl acrylate monomer produced under the conditions of the experiment is dependent upon the number of ethyl acrylate–methyl methacrylate bonds contained in the copolymer. These observations were made possible by a standardized samples-handling technique in which a uniformsize disk was pyrolyzed at a maximum pyrolysis temperature of 600°C. This enabled reproducible pyrolysis gas chromatograms to be obtained and permitted pyrolysis products of copolymers containing different ratios of ethyl acrylate and methyl methacrylate to be compared. An examination of sequence distribution data, obtained with the aid of a sequence distribution program for copolymers, showed sufficient agreement with the pyrolysis data to support the hypothesis. It has been demonstrated that pyrolysis gas chromatography may be applied to experimentally determine the sequence distribution of copolymers. 相似文献

Engagement of the antigen receptor on WEHI 231 murine B lymphoma cells leads to growth arrest and induction of apoptosis. Concomitant signaling through CD40 sustains proliferation and rescues the cells from apoptosis. At the molecular level, CD40 has been shown to activate nuclear factor kappaB (NF-kappaB) and stress-activated protein kinase (SAPK). The aim of our present study was to define the stretch of the CD40 cytoplasmic tail responsible for mediating these effects in WEHI 231 cells. Using recombinant retroviruses with the enhanced green fluorescent protein as selection marker we transduced WEHI 231 cells with chimeric molecules consisting of the extracellular and transmembrane region of human CD40 or rat CD4 and selected portions of the murine CD40 tail. Chimeric molecules with cytoplasmic fragments encompassing the "CD40 tumor necrosis factor-associated factor family member interacting motif" (TIM) were able to sustain growth and to uphold NF-kappaB activity as efficiently as the whole intracellular region of CD40. While the potential of the motif relative to the whole cytoplasmic tail was independent of the heterologous part of the chimeras it was strongly influenced by its distance to the membrane. Placing the 17-amino acid stretch of the motif too close to the membrane, i. e. only two or four amino acids apart, destroyed its capacity to mitigate the anti-IgM effect. Activation of SAPK through the chimeric molecules always correlated with their ability to activate NF-kappaB activity and to rescue the cells from apoptosis induced by antigen receptor ligation. Our data indicate that CD40-TIM carries most if not all of the information needed to deliver the signals responsible for sustaining growth in anti-IgM-stimulated WEHI 231 cells. 相似文献

This study was designed to determine if the positive and negative inotropic actions of alpha-1-adrenergic agonists in rat atrial and ventricular myocardium are mediated via different alpha-1-adrenergic receptor (AR) subtypes. Inotropic effects of phenylephrine were examined in isolated left atrial and papillary muscle before and after treatment with prazosin, WB4101 (N-[2-(2,6-dimethoxyphenoxy)ethyl]-2,3-dihydro-1,4-benzodioxin+ ++-2-methanamine), chloroethylclonidine (CEC) and WB4101 plus CEC. Phenylephrine (10 microM) elicited a monophasic positive inotropic response in left atrial muscle and a triphasic inotropic action in papillary muscle (transient positive, then negative inotropic components preceding a sustained positive inotropic response). CEC, WB4101 and prazosin each antagonized the monophasic response in isolated left atria and the sustained positive inotropic response in papillary muscle. CEC and prazosin each antagonized the transient negative inotropic component in papillary muscle. The transient positive inotropic response was not affected by CEC, WB4101 or CEC plus WB4101, but was antagonized by higher concentrations of prazosin. These data suggest that the sustained positive inotropic effect of alpha-1-adrenergic agonists in rat atrial and ventricular myocardium results from stimulation of alpha-1A and alpha-1B ARs, whereas the transient negative inotropic component of the triphasic response in ventricular preparations is mediated via alpha-1B ARs. However, present data do not exclude the possibility that the CEC-sensitive inotropic responses elicited by phenylephrine may be mediated in part by other recently described alpha-1 subtypes. The receptors involved in the transient positive inotropic action cannot be identified by current results. 相似文献

Two dibasic esters, the dimethyl ester of hexanedioic acid (dimethyl adipate, DBE-6) and the dimethyl ester of pentanedioic acid (dimethyl glutarate, DBE-5) were found in head-thorax extracts of male Echinothrips americanus. DBE-5 induced abdomen wagging and raising in males and females, which is typically exhibited when encountering a male. DBE-6 was avoided by males and was detected on mated, but not on virgin, females. Both substances applied to virgin females lead to females being ignored by males. The role of both substances is discussed with regard to the male mating system. 相似文献

Methods which have been proposed for measuring the strength of enamels, by means of impact tests, are not entirely applicable to enameled flat ware, where the ordinary strains are due to bending of the sheets. An apparatus has been devised by means of which bending stresses can be applied in gradually increasing increments so that the normal behavior of enamels under such stresses can be observed and measured. 相似文献
